What's the average arm span of a person?
The mean arm span was 159.14 cm (SD=7.06), which was on average 2 cm more than standing height. There was a strong positive correlation of arm span and leg length with standing height.
Can a person's stature be measured from arm span?
There are many conditions in which stature cannot be measured accurately, for example paralysis, fractures, amputation, scoliosis and pain, etc. In such cases, the stature estimated from arm span is generally used to derive predicted values for pulmonary function.
